OBESITY AND OVERWEIGHT It is estimated that 10,000,000 children ages 6-19 are considered overweight or obese. It is estimated that over 10% of preschool children between the ages of 2 and 5 are overweight.
Since 1990 the prevalence of those who are obese increased by 75%. This increase reached across every ethnic group.
The cost related to obesity and overweight among children is a stunning and shocking $127 MILLION DOLLARS.
INACTIVITY IN CHILDREN A little more than half of high school students are enrolled in physical education classes from grades 9-12. At age seventeen, more than half of female students report no physical activity. Hispanics and Blacks carry the largest segment of the population who have little or no physical or leisure activity.
